    Abstract: In accordance with exemplary embodiments, a magnetic decklid damper system is provided for a vehicle. The system comprises a decklid coupled to a body of the vehicle via a hinge strap facilitating the decklid moving between a closed position and an open position. The hinge strap includes a first magnetic element coupled to the hinge strap, and a second magnetic element coupled to a body member of the vehicle. The first and second magnetic elements have a common polarity to magnetically repel each other as the decklid moves toward the open position to provide a damping effect for the decklid.

    Abstract: A closing and opening device for a furniture element is mounted movably on an item of furniture. The device includes a lockable ejection device for moving the movable furniture element out of a closed end position into an open position, and further includes a magnetic retaining device for the movably mounted furniture element. The magnetic retaining device includes at least two parts of which a first part is or can be arranged on the furniture body and the second part is or can be arranged on the movable furniture element and which exert a magnetic attraction force on each other at least in the closed position of the movable furniture element. The first part of the retaining device, that is arranged on the furniture body, is mounted movably in the direction of the movable furniture element and is acted upon by a force storage means acting in the closing direction of the movable furniture element.

    Abstract: A sliding door system includes at least one sliding door having an upper and lower sliding-door mount, as well as an upper and lower guide rail for displaceably receiving the upper and lower sliding-door mount, respectively. The guide rails extend parallel to each other and each have a clear inner width that is at least twice as large as the thickness of the sliding door. The upper and lower sliding-door mounts are each at most half as wide as the clear inner width of each guide rail, allowing moving the sliding door into recessed and lifted-out positions, each constituting a stable state. By overcoming a resistance force, the sliding door can be moved between stable states. The sliding door system is lightweight and robust, and enables sliding doors to be displaced freely without a particular sliding door being assigned in a fixed manner to a particular opening to be covered.

    Abstract: A sliding panel structure. The sliding panel structure includes a frame having an upper support track and a lower guide rail. At least one sliding panel is connected between the upper support track and the lower guide rail. The sliding panel includes a sliding panel pivot axis and an extension for riding in the lower guide rail. The extension prevents undesired pivoting of the sliding panel about the sliding panel pivot axis. A mutual attraction device is connected between the sliding panel and the frame with a first mutual attraction part connected to the frame and the second mutual attraction part connected to the sliding panel. A fulcrum is utilized for tilting the sliding panel whenever the first mutual attraction part engages the second mutual attraction part. The tilting of the sliding panel causes the extension to disengage the lower guide rail which allows the sliding panel to pivot about the sliding panel pivot axis. In a preferred embodiment the sliding panel structure includes at least one stationary pivoting panel. In another preferred embodiment the sliding panel is a plurality of sliding panels. In another preferred embodiment the sliding panel is a sliding door. In another preferred embodiment the sliding panel is a sliding window. In another preferred embodiment the mutual attraction device is utilizes magnetic force so that a magnet connected to the sliding panel is attracted to a magnet connected to the frame.

    Abstract: A support system includes a frame member and a cover magnetically coupled to one another proximate an edge of the cover and in an aligned state. The cover is rotatable with respect to the frame member without any structural coupling therebetween while the frame member and cover remain substantially in the aligned state. A method of supporting a cover with respect to a frame includes magnetically attracting the cover and frame to each other proximate an edge of the cover.

    Abstract: The invention is an access operating device equipped with a photovoltaic housing, and in particular, an access device, for example a movable barrier operator, equipped with a housing, which has been retrofitted with a photovoltaic substrate or film, and adapted to convert energy, for example solar energy, to an electrical power source for powering the movable barrier operator or access operating device. The photovoltaic housing is used to draw light energy and convert it to an electrical power supply for the operator's various devices, for example, a controller and motor.
